  • Asset Manager - Asset Management

    The Asset Manager will be responsible for managing a portfolio of multi-family real estate partnerships to preserve the value of Investor Equity and the stream of benefits associated with that Investment; develop and maintain strong relations with lender representatives, management agents, local officials, and general Partners in a portfolio; manage reposition situations which include refinancing, general partner substitution, legal action, partnership restructuring, recapitalization, as well as Section 42 non-compliance issues; conduct site visit evaluations; analyze annual audited financial statements; review and monitor quarterly operational reports and evaluate Partnership performance through pre-established benchmarks.

    Minimum of 2 years experience in asset management and property financial analysis. Must have a BS / BA degree, excellent analytical skills, be highly organized, and have strong computer, verbal and written skills. Real Estate experience is required.

  • Investment Analyst - Asset Management

    Job Responsibilities include:

    • Analyzing annual audited financial statements to evaluate operational performance.
    • Reviewing site visit reports and following up with General Partners and Management Companies on issues.
    • Evaluating requests for the release of equity by reviewing Partnership Agreements and other partnership documents to determine if required benchmarks such as Tax Credit allocation, construction completion, stabilized occupancy, and break-even operations have been met.
    • Monitoring construction progress through the review of monthly construction draw requests.

    Candidate must have:

    • Bachelor's degree
    • Strong written and verbal communication skills
    • Excellent analytical skills
    • Experience or internship in a similar work environment a plus.
    • Real estate experience preferred
